STEERING PAD INSTALLATION

CAUTION / NOTICE / HINT

Tech Tips


  • Use the same procedure for RHD and LHD vehicles.

  • The procedure listed below is for LHD vehicles.

PROCEDURE


  1. INSTALL STEERING PAD


    1. Check that the ignition switch is off.

    2. Check that the cable is disconnected from the negative (-) battery terminal.

      CAUTION:

      Wait at least 90 seconds after disconnecting the cable from the negative (-) battery terminal to disable the SRS system.

    3. A01XF74

      Support the steering pad with one hand.

    4. Connect the 2 connectors to the steering pad.

      Note

      When handling the airbag connector, take care not to damage the airbag wire harness.

    5. Connect the horn connector.

    6. Confirm that the groove along the circumference of the "TORX" screw is attached to the screw case and place the steering pad onto the steering wheel.

    7. Using a T30 "TORX" socket wrench, tighten the 2 screws.

      Torque:
      8.8 N*m  { 90 kgf*cm, 78 in.*lbf }
  2. INSTALL LOWER NO. 3 STEERING WHEEL COVER


    1. Attach the 2 claws to install the cover.

  5. INSPECT STEERING PAD


    1. With the steering pad installed on the vehicle, perform a visual check. If there are any defects as mentioned below, replace the steering pad with a new one:

      Cuts, minute cracks or marked discoloration on the steering pad top surface or in the grooved portion.

    2. Make sure that the horn sounds.

      If the horn does not sound, inspect the horn system.
